US Dept of Education:

Duncan declares "ALL MEANS ALL"

"I want to say-here and now, for the record-we are moving away from the 2 percent rule," he stressed.  "We will not issue another policy that allows districts to disguise the educational performance of 2 percent of students."  Instead, he continued, "We have to expect the very best from our students-and tell the truth about student performance-so that we can give all students the supports and services they need." In prepared remarks to the American Association of People with Disabilities, Secretary Duncan declared students with disabilities should be judged with the same accountability system as everyone else.  Learn more and watch a video of Duncan's remarks.

Kansas Vulnerable Needs Planning System

A system that allows residents with special needs the opportunity to provide information to assist in planning to meet their needs before, during and after emergencies.

Who are We?

Families Together, Inc. is the statewide organization that assists parents and their sons and daughters with disabilities. Our program's mission is to encourage, educate, and empower families to be effective advocates for their own children.

 

Families Together, Inc. is dedicated to a society that includes and values all people. We offer families the security of belonging to a support network of other parents that face similar goals, challenges and needs.
